Commercial ro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. Skilled inspectors examine the roof’s surface, structural components, drainage systems, and flashing to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. These evaluations often include checking for leaks, cracks, ponding water, and areas where the roofing material may be compromised.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of’s current condition and to pinpoint areas that may require maintenance or repairs to prevent future problems.

Inspection Costs - Commercial roof inspection services typically range from $200 to $600,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. For example, a standard flat roof in Eldon, MO, might cost around $350. Variations depend on the scope and local contractor rates.
Service Fees - The fee for a comprehensive roof inspection usually falls between $150 and $500. Smaller commercial buildings may be on the lower end, while larger or more complex roofs can cost more. Local service providers set these rates based on project specifics.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may apply for detailed assessments, drone inspections, or specialized testing, often adding $100 to $300 to the base price. For instance, a detailed infrared scan could increase the total by approximately $200.
Estimate Variability - Cost estimates vary widely depending on roof size, height, and inspection type, with typical ranges from $250 to $700. Contact local pros for precise quotes tailored to specific commercial roof conditions in Eldon, MO.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is included in a commercial roof inspection? A commercial roof inspection typically involves evaluating the roof's surface, checking for damage, leaks, and wear, and assessing overall structural integrity.
How often should a commercial roof be inspected? It is recommended to have commercial roofs inspected at least once a year and after any severe weather events.
What signs indicate a roof may need repairs? Signs include visible damage, water stains on ceilings, pooling water, and damaged or missing roofing materials.
Can a roof inspection identify potential issues before they become serious? Yes, inspections can reveal early signs of damage or deterioration that may require maintenance or repairs.
